Brief History of VR in Gaming
The journey of virtual reality in gaming began in the 1960s with the invention of the Sensorama, a multi-sensory simulator. This early device laid the groundwork for future developments. It was a groundbreaking concept. In the 1980s, the first VR arcade games emerged, capturing the public’s imagination. These games offered a glimpse into immersive experiences. They were revolutionary for their time.
The 1990s saw significant advancements with the introduction of the Virtuality Group’s arcade machines. These machines featured headsets and motion tracking, enhancing player engagement. This was a pivotal moment in gaming history. However, the technology was expensive and limited in scope, leading to a decline in interest. Many thought it was a fad.
In the 2010s, VR experienced a resurgence with the launch of consumer headsets like the Oculus Rift and HTC Vive. These devices made VR more accessible and affordable. The market began to expand rapidly. Investors recognized the potential for growth, leading to increased funding for VR game development. The financial landscape shifted dramatically.

Current Trends in VR Gaming
Popular VR Games and Platforms
Several popular VR games have emerged, showcasing the technology’s potential. Titles like “Beat Saber” and “Half-Life: Alyx” have garnered critical acclaim. These games offer unique experiences that engage players on multiple levels. They are truly innovative.
Platforms such as Oculus Quest, PlayStation VR, and HTC Vive have become industry leaders. Each platform provides distinct features and capabilities. This variety caters to different gaming preferences. He notes that accessibility is key for growth.
Current trends indicate a shift towards social VR experiences. Games like “Rec Room” and “VRChat” allow users to interact in virtual spaces. This social aspect enhances user engagement. It’s fascinating to see how communities form.

Technical Limitations and Accessibility Issues
Despite the advancements in virtual reality, several technical limitations persist. For instance, high-quality VR systems often require powerful hardware. This can create a barrier for potential users. Many cannot afford the necessary equipment.
Moreover, the physical space required for VR experiences can live restrictive. Users need adequate room to move freely, which is not always available. This limitation can hinder widespread adoption. It’s a significant concern.
In addition, motion sickness remains a common issue for many players. The disconnect between visual input and physical movement can lead to discomfort. This affects user experience and retention. He believes addressing this is crucial for future growth.
Furthermore, accessibility issues arise for individuals with disabilities. Many VR games do not accommodate diverse needs, limiting participation. This exclusion can impact market potential. It’s an important consideration for developers.
